Longeville-lès-Metz is a commune in the Moselle department in the Grand Est region of northeastern France, near the city of Metz. It is not an independent country, but rather a local administrative region of France. It has a long history, dating back to Roman times, and has a rich cultural heritage. It is strategically located near the Moselle River and is surrounded by a hilly landscape with a mild climate.
